Output 33d521cb3c04b9c49930f0b1e53b410e684ae7505afe55931162c0be10f3bcbd:1

value
5000000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e87e01407857bd35c82ff5292bfdc91cb35d2e78 OP_EQUAL
address
3NtKe2D6HoEgyhQ3zsCw5g937sx6iLE8WV
transaction
33d521cb3c04b9c49930f0b1e53b410e684ae7505afe55931162c0be10f3bcbd
confirmations
415614
spent
true